The Manufacturing Process

Kraft Paper Production

Kraft paper is produced using the kraft process, a chemical pulping method that involves the treatment of wood chips with a mixture of sodium hydroxide and sodium sulfide. This process removes lignin, a natural polymer that binds wood fibers together, resulting in stronger and more durable paper. The kraft process also allows for the recovery and reuse of chemicals, making it more sustainable compared to other pulping methods.

Key Characteristics

Strength and Durability

One of the most notable differences between kraft paper and normal paper is their strength. Kraft paper is significantly stronger due to its low lignin content and long fibers, making it ideal for heavy-duty applications such as packaging and industrial use. In contrast, normal paper is less durable and is primarily used for writing, printing, and other lightweight applications.

Appearance

Kraft paper typically has a natural brown color, although it can be bleached to produce white kraft paper. Its rustic appearance is often associated with eco-friendliness and sustainability. Normal paper, on the other hand, is usually white or brightly colored, offering a more polished and professional look suitable for office and educational purposes.

Environmental Impact

Kraft paper is considered more environmentally friendly due to its recyclable and biodegradable nature. The kraft process also generates less waste and allows for the recovery of chemicals. Normal paper, while recyclable, often involves more chemical treatments and bleaching, which can have a higher environmental footprint.

Applications

Uses of Kraft Paper

Kraft paper is widely used in packaging, including the production of Kraft Paper Bag, which is popular for its strength and eco-friendliness. Other applications include wrapping, cushioning, and industrial uses such as cement bags and protective layers for shipping.

Uses of Normal Paper

Normal paper is predominantly used for writing, printing, and creating books, magazines, and newspapers. Its smooth surface and ability to hold ink make it ideal for these purposes. Additionally, it is used in arts and crafts, where its versatility and availability are advantageous.
